A Glasgow voice : James Kelman's literary language / by Christine Amanda Müller.

This book focuses on James Kelman, a leading Scottish author, and his use of language. It examines how Kelman presents a spoken Glasgow working-class voice in his stories while breaking down the traditional distinction made between speech and writing in l.
